For the academic year 2023-2024,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Colleges In Virginia is 69.71%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 15.83%. A total of 33,718 have applied, 23,506 admitted, and 3,722 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Colleges In Virginia.
Hampton University is the tightest school to admit with 48.00% acceptance rate, and Averett University has the second lowest acceptance rate of 48.01%.
